|
Jive Forums API (5.5.8) Core Javadocs |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com.jivesoftware.base.GroupManagerFactory
public class GroupManagerFactory
A factory that returns a concrete instance of a group manager.
| Field Summary | |
|---|---|
static com.jivesoftware.util.Cache |
groupCache
A cache for group objects. |
static com.jivesoftware.util.Cache |
groupIDCache
A cache that maps group names to ID's. |
static com.jivesoftware.util.Cache |
groupMemberCache
A cache for the list members of in each group.This cache is not instantiated until after this factory is initialized. |
| Method Summary | |
|---|---|
static void |
addListener(GroupListener listener)
Method used internally by Jive. |
void |
destroy()
|
static void |
dispatchEvent(JiveEvent event)
Method used internally by Jive. |
static void |
doInitialize()
|
static GroupManager |
getInstance()
Returns a concrete instance of the group manager interface. |
void |
initialize()
|
static void |
removeListener(GroupListener listener)
Method used internally by Jive.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
|---|
public static com.jivesoftware.util.Cache groupCache
public static com.jivesoftware.util.Cache groupIDCache
public static com.jivesoftware.util.Cache groupMemberCache
| Method Detail |
|---|
public static GroupManager getInstance()
Note: in general, this method is not intended to be called by outside users of the API. Doing so is dangerous since the GroupManager implementation returned will not be secured by a protection proxy.
public void initialize()
initialize in interface com.jivesoftware.base.JiveManagerpublic void destroy()
destroy in interface com.jivesoftware.base.JiveManagerpublic static void doInitialize()
public static void addListener(GroupListener listener)
public static void removeListener(GroupListener listener)
public static void dispatchEvent(JiveEvent event)
|
Jive Forums Project Page |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||